| The Kisan Gate is one of the seven ancient city-gates through Damascus' Roman-era wall (today located in the south-eastern part of the Old City); the gate is also famous for being the escape route out of Damacus for Saint Paul, which was later isolated and the remnant converted into the Chapel of Saint Paul. |
